Sachs Bee 2 - 2013 Specifications and Reviews

The 2013 Sachs Bee 2 is a lightweight 49cc scooter designed for urban commuters and novice riders seeking affordable, economical transport. Its automatic CVT transmission and modest 4.3 horsepower engine deliver reliable city-speed performance up to 45 km/h, making it ideal for short-distance daily commuting with minimal maintenance requirements.

Rider Profile

Best ForIdeal for brand-new riders or moped-license holders with little to no prior riding experience.
PurposeBuilt purely for short, low-speed trips around town such as commuting to school, work, or running errands.
Rider FitVery light and low seat height make it easy to handle for smaller or less physically strong riders.
CharacterA humble, no-frills 50cc runabout that prioritizes simplicity, economy, and easy manageability over performance.
Not Ideal ForNot suitable for highway travel, long-distance touring, carrying a passenger comfortably, or riders seeking any real performance.
